![]() |
Модераторы: LSD, AntonSaburov |
![]() ![]() ![]() |
|
LSD |
|
|||
![]() Leprechaun Software Developer 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 15718 Регистрация: 24.3.2004 Где: Dublin Репутация: 210 Всего: 538 |
При работе с БД часто бывает нужно получить некоторую информацию о структуре базы данных: список таблиц, процедур, поддерживает ли БД ту или иную функцию.
Для получения подобной информации предназначен класс DatabaseMetaData. Получить экземпляр данного класса, можно от Connection-на. Существует аналогичный класс для результатов запросов: ResultSetMetaData - он возвращает информацию о ResultSet, имена столбцов, их типы, тип курсора и т.д. Для примера получим и распечатаем, список всех таблиц в базе данных (в зависимости от реализации, БД может возвращать информацию не о всех таблицах, а только о таблицах доступных данному пользователю):
-------------------- Disclaimer: this post contains explicit depictions of personal opinion. So, if it sounds sarcastic, don't take it seriously. If it sounds dangerous, do not try this at home or at all. And if it offends you, just don't read it. |
|||
|
||||
![]() ![]() ![]() |
Правила форума "Java" | |
|
Если Вам помогли, и атмосфера форума Вам понравилась, то заходите к нам чаще! С уважением, LSD, AntonSaburov, powerOn, tux, javastic.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Java: Общие вопросы |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|